Merge remote-tracking branch 'remotes/alistair/tags/pull-riscv-to-apply-20201217-1' into staging
A collection of RISC-V improvements: - Improve the sifive_u DTB generation - Add QSPI NOR flash to Microchip PFSoC - Fix a bug in the Hypervisor HLVX/HLV/HSV instructions - Fix some mstatus mask defines - Ibex PLIC improvements - OpenTitan memory layout update - Initial steps towards support for 32-bit CPUs on 64-bit builds # gpg: Signature made Fri 18 Dec 2020 05:59:42 GMT # gpg: using RSA key F6C4AC46D4934868D3B8CE8F21E10D29DF977054 # gpg: Good signature from "Alistair Francis <alistair@alistair23.me>" [full] # Primary key fingerprint: F6C4 AC46 D493 4868 D3B8 CE8F 21E1 0D29 DF97 7054 * remotes/alistair/tags/pull-riscv-to-apply-20201217-1: (23 commits) riscv/opentitan: Update the OpenTitan memory layout hw/riscv: Use the CPU to determine if 32-bit target/riscv: cpu: Set XLEN independently from target target/riscv: csr: Remove compile time XLEN checks target/riscv: cpu_helper: Remove compile time XLEN checks target/riscv: cpu: Remove compile time XLEN checks target/riscv: Specify the XLEN for CPUs target/riscv: Add a riscv_cpu_is_32bit() helper function target/riscv: fpu_helper: Match function defs in HELPER macros hw/riscv: sifive_u: Remove compile time XLEN checks hw/riscv: spike: Remove compile time XLEN checks hw/riscv: virt: Remove compile time XLEN checks hw/riscv: boot: Remove compile time XLEN checks riscv: virt: Remove target macro conditionals riscv: spike: Remove target macro conditionals target/riscv: Add a TYPE_RISCV_CPU_BASE CPU hw/riscv: Expand the is 32-bit check to support more CPUs intc/ibex_plic: Clear interrupts that occur during claim process target/riscv: Fix definition of MSTATUS_TW and MSTATUS_TSR target/riscv: Fix the bug of HLVX/HLV/HSV ...
